Iphigenia in Aulis adapts the overture from Gluck’s opera for grade 3 string orchestra. Kirk Moss’s abbreviated arrangement runs 4:05 and supplies clearly marked bowings and fingerings. Those markings give players concrete reference points during preparation, helping the ensemble spend rehearsal time on the musical detail of the overture rather than establishing every bowing and fingering from scratch.
